Good-temperedness
Good-temperedness noun - The state or quality of having a pleasant or agreeable manner in socializing with others.
Usage example: the volunteer's general good-temperedness was infectious and lifted the spirits of those waiting to give blood
Kindness and good-temperedness are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Kindness" instead a noun phrase "Good-temperedness".
Kindness
Kindness noun - Sympathetic concern for the well-being of others.
Usage example: with touching kindness, the couple offered the stranded tourists a place to stay for the night
Good-temperedness and kindness are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Good-temperedness" instead a noun "Kindness".
